What is MCP Partner Hub?

MCP Partner Hub is a centralized repository for discovering and comparing Model Context Protocol (MCP) servers from ISV partners. It is designed for users who need to find, evaluate, and choose MCP servers that extend AI capabilities with external tools and data sources.

How to use MCP Partner Hub?

Users browse the list of available MCP servers, review standardized documentation, and use the comparison guide. They can also contribute by submitting pull requests or opening issues with new partner servers.

FAQ from MCP Partner Hub

What is the purpose of MCP Partner Hub?

It serves as a central place to discover, compare, and learn about MCP servers provided by ISV partners, helping users find the right server for their needs.

Which partners are currently listed?

The hub features servers from partners such as Zilliz, OceanBase, StarRocks, Databricks, Snowflake, MongoDB, PagerDuty, and others—each with links to their repositories and documentation.

How can I contribute to MCP Partner Hub?

You can submit a pull request or open an issue if you know of an MCP server that should be included. The repository follows a Contributing Guide for details.

Does MCP Partner Hub include documentation for each server?

Yes, each partner entry has a link to its documentation or blog post, along with a link to the server’s GitHub repository.

What license applies to MCP Partner Hub?

The repository is licensed under the MIT License, as described in the LICENSE file.
